  1. Yeah I like this. Im not maybe quite as mad about it as Geoff (it definitely wont be my fav), but there are a few great songs on here....and what I thought (on first listen) were a couple of filler as well. I completely agree on 'Start Over', 'Tell Me' (highlight of the disc) and 'Wasted'. But i'd also add 'Dirty Girl' (G - hope that wasnt your filler!!) which completely kicked my arse and is awesome. There are one or two choruses which just didnt quite live up and I found myself hitting forward a couple of times, but overall a good solid modern album with strong vocals and great playing.....one thing I would add is that one song had a short guitar solo and I found myself thinking if only theyd thrown a few more in!   6. Err - A big fat no to that statement! As I said above Twice, comparable with a more AOR'ish Bad Company and certainly no lighter than alot of 'AOR' discs past/present and it certainly has some bite to it in places. Steve Overland sounds brilliant on this and this is pretty much a pre-cursor to the excellent FM, although not as produced and a more slightly bluesy, less keyboard edge. An album that is held in high esteem by quite a few AOR fans, and pretty much a no brainer to be honest. Backed 100%
